I bought the 75th Anniversary book when it came out. While I did enjoy it, I did feel it was overpriced for what I got. It is only 143 pages and it contains mostly pictures. About 95% or more of the information (though not 100%) contained in the book can be found through various links/documents on the National website. Thus why I felt it was overpriced, because outside of pictures, the information and history presented was not really new or going beyond. I have not seen it for sale on the website in a while. It is possible they may have sold out of them. I have seen them on eBay however so you may want to try there.

As to your original question of pictures being available of some of our first sisters, there is a photo in the book of sisters attending the first Founder's Day celebration in Vinita, Oklahoma in April 1932. That is the oldest photo. There is another picture from 1939 from a Pledge Ritual. All other photos are from the 40's and beyond.
